The OPW 53-V Series Float Vent Valves are designed <br />" to be installed in OPW 233-V Series extractor fittings to <br />form a system to help prevent product mixing, and to <br />meet the Federal EPA technical standards for overfill <br />prevention of petroleum UST's. <br />The OPW 53-V Series Float Vent Valves have a <br />stainless steel ball which in an overfill condition, seats <br />tightly against a specially designed valve seat, restricting <br />the flow of vapors back to the delivery transport, or tank <br />vent. The pressure created in the UST by this vapor <br />flow restriction works against the head of liquid remain- <br />ing in the delivery transport and hoses, to reduce the <br />incoming flow rate.
